This study carried out a statistical analysis of attitudinal changes towards female breadwinners in Wukari Local Government Area, Taraba State, Nigeria. Using a survey research method, a sample of 400 were examined. Primary data were collected using structured questionnaire and analysed using frequency counts and simple percent. Hypothesis were tested using the chi-square statistic. Soils along the Toposequence of Tsokundi River in Wukari LGA of Taraba State,Nigeria were studied with the aim of characterizing them for sustainable crop production.Three soil units (Upper, Middle and Lower slopes) were identified in the area. The soilswere generally deep (100 to 122 cm). The studied soils from upper and lower slope werewell drained whereas, that of the middle slope was poorly drained. This study was on the econometrics of socio-economic characteristics of farmers on poultry-egg production in Wukari LGA of Taraba State. The study specifically, identified the socio-economic characteristics of the farmers, determined the socio-economic factors that affected poultry-egg output and identified the constraints associated with poultry-egg farming in the study area. Primary data were collected from 150 poultry-egg producers in the study area. The data collected were subjected to descriptive statistics and multiple regression analysis.
